Murph and IT staff reported support for a county website revamp; Gardner said the site must be ADA-compliant by 2027 and demos with CIVIC Plus and Municode were scheduled (one demo set for Feb. 25, CivicPlus demo rescheduled for March 4). Becky Holme was recommended to be heavily involved.

Murph told the committee that Economic Development supports a county website revamp and recommended heavy involvement from Becky Holme. Danny Gardner told the committee the county website must be ADA compliant by 2027 and that the county can hire a hosting company to help meet that requirement; Roy Haeger noted that Hurley School pays an estimated $4,000 for similar services.

Gardner said he has demos scheduled with CIVIC Plus and Municode (a demo noted for Feb. 25 at 11:00 AM and a CivicPlus demo later rescheduled for March 4). Roxanne Lutgen asked to reschedule the Feb. 25 demo because she will be in Madison; Roy Haeger, Joe Miller and Becky Holme were listed to attend the original demo time. The committee discussed digitizing the county ordinance book and potential funding sources such as ARPA or grants; Joe Miller will investigate options.
